Abstract :
Vibration power generation is one of energy harvesting technologies using renewable energy. In this paper, a novel vibration power generation device for vehicles where effective power generation can be obtained by multi-mode vibration of the vehicles is presented. First, road tests of the vehicle are performed, and then the obtained data is analyzed. Next, a vibration power generation device specially designed for the vehicle is proposed. This new device is composed of the multiple masses and spring plates equipped with a lead zirconate titanate (PZT), and is effective in multi-mode vibration. The validity of the developed device is confirmed by the simulation and experimental results.
